Output 8596fc3ba04ef7d3f77eaf71df3fe8625ebcfa38bbc030c172d83cc03dc08960:0

value
608475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d74157908dc11d1c2c860b35ef1137a9b6ae55a0 OP_EQUAL
address
3MKBUqEj7kTBsRAhVEpyWKCsMzjZWnZdc5
transaction
8596fc3ba04ef7d3f77eaf71df3fe8625ebcfa38bbc030c172d83cc03dc08960
confirmations
396575
spent
true